Can You Spot Yourself In This Famous Clip Of The Mainland HS Marching Band?
Well, nobody would really call Atlantic City a "popular" shooting location within the film industry, but the city has certainly been used as a backdrop in more than a few movies.
One such film was "The King Of Marvin Gardens". Filmed in and around Atlantic City in the early 1970s, the plot follows a man named Jason (Bruce Dern) attempting to get his radio-host brother (Jack Nicholson) to hop on board on a get-rich-quick type of scheme involving a mob boss, prostitutes, the whole nine yards.

There's a scene that takes place on the Atlantic City boardwalk that features the Mainland High School Marching Band from the 1972-1973 school year. Many students' faces can be seen as clear as day in the scene where Jack Nicholson and Bruce Dern pass by the band marching down the boardwalk.
What an epic moment for South Jersey! An even bigger one for the kids of the marching band....
